Eggnog is a frothy, sweet, and creamy milk-based beverage.

Some variants also contain alcohol and go by the name egg milk punch.

Though it originated in the UK, it’s a popular drink in many places today.

1 – Antipasto Skewers

A dish of various ingredients will match nicely with eggnog, and you can have a complete meal.

Antipasto is a good idea, but you can make the skewer version instead of serving the food on a platter.

It will look more appealing and is more convenient for guests too.

Instead of placing one item after another on their plate, they can take a skewer each and enjoy the food.

You can add various items to the antipasto skewers, like tomato, artichoke hearts, grilled asparagus, salami, cheese, olives, and tortellini.

4 – Sourcream Lemon Cake

If you want something sweet, sour, and fragrant to serve with eggnog, the sour cream lemon cake will fit on your menu nicely.

You can make the cake in a Bundt pan to create the best-shaped cake.

Sour cream gets its flavor from the addition of lactic acid bacteria to the cream.

It’s then left to ferment for one day.

There are different types of sour cream with more or less fat.

So, you can choose a variety you like.

The lemon juice and sour cream add a nice tang to the cake.

They also balance the sweetness When baked, you’ll have a lovely-looking cake with beautiful flavors.

5 – Pretzel Bites

Do you like chewy snacks with slightly salty flavor? If yes, pretzel bites fit the bill nicely.

They make a lovely combo with eggnog too.

Pretzels are old-fashioned but still widely popular because of their uniqueness.

One aspect separates pretzel bites from others.

It’s dipping the dough in an alkaline solution.

It makes the snacks brown and glossy. Making pretzel bites is also simple.

6 – Cheese Pecan Wafers

It’s truly amazing to learn that some foods/dishes taste good even with few ingredients.

Cheese pecan wafers are among those items.

They taste delightful and also match exceptionally well with eggnog.

When you taste wafers, you may think they contain many items, but it’s the opposite.

You’ll need only six ingredients: pecans (halves), all-purpose flour, red ground pepper, salt, Cheddar cheese, and butter.

9 – Chocolate Bread Pudding

It’s another delicious dessert that complements eggnog.

It looks super good and even complex. But it’s one of the simplest dishes to make.

It takes only one hour and five minutes to prep and cook the dessert.

Even though the pudding is tasty, it doesn’t need unusual ingredients.

The primary item is, in fact, stale bread, along with eggs, milk, cocoa, chocolate chips, and sugar.

It’s essential to follow the recommended time and not go beyond it.

Else, the pudding will get too dry and won’t taste fantastic.
